Related products and categories
- Pickled Ginger: Pickled ginger is a type of canned ginger that has been preserved in vinegar and spices. It is a popular condiment in many Asian cuisines, often served as a condiment with sushi or other dishes. Pickled ginger is also great for adding flavor to salads or stir-fries.
- Marinated Ginger: Marinated ginger is a type of canned ginger that has been marinated in a flavorful sauce, usually made from soy sauce, sake, mirin, and sugar. It's used mostly as an ingredient in Japanese cuisine such as teriyaki chicken and tempura shrimp. Marinated ginger can also be used as part of a marinade for grilling meats and vegetables.
- Candied Ginger: Candied ginger is another form of canned ginger that has been preserved in syrup or honey. It's often added to recipes to add sweetness and spice at the same time. Candied ginger can be used to make cookies, cakes, scones and other desserts; it also pairs well with fruits like apples and pears.
- Preserved Ginger: Preserved ginger is another type of canned product which consists of thin slices of fresh root which have been cooked briefly before being coated with sugar syrup which preserves them for extended periods of time without refrigeration. Due to its sweet taste it can also be used as an ingredient in desserts like cakes and ice cream. It's also great for adding flavour to sauces and curries.
- Powdered Ginger: Powdered ginger is dehydrated ground up pieces of the root which are then ground into a fine powder before being canned. This makes it much easier to store than fresh root while still retaining all the flavourful components found within it such as citronella and zingerone which lend it its distinctive spicy notes when included in dishes such as curries or stews.
